Commission approves traffic study at Sussex Road and Scottwood Drive near Red Smith School
Summary
The Green Bay Traffic/Parking Commission voted to commission a baseline traffic study, including a crossing-guard warrant count, for Sussex Road near Scottwood Drive and Red Smith School. The study responds to a planned 400‑unit development and resident safety concerns; county approval will be needed for any changes to Scottwood.
The Green Bay Traffic/Parking Commission on March 17 approved a staff-led traffic study to evaluate vehicle and pedestrian conditions at the intersection of Sussex Road and Scottwood Drive near Red Smith School and to perform a crossing‑guard warrant count.
Alder Grant said the study should establish a baseline now because a proposed development nearby is projected to add about 400 units and the change could increase school‑time crossings. “The development is projected to take about 10 years, which is why I'm kinda pushing to do this now to see if they qualify now,” Alder Grant said.
